Broadband Access and Service Testing

SCENARIO

“Broadband” describes high-speed internet access for end customers via wireless, cable, or digital subscriber line (DSL). Broadband requires numerous protocols and devices to work together seamlessly to provide reliable customer internet access, especially when rolling out new services that consume larger amounts of bandwidth. Without sufficient testing of broadband network protocols, equipment, and network topologies, business suffers due to unreliable customer access.

Testing services over broadband access is a critical factor in providing excellent quality of experience (QoE) to end users, whether they are enterprises, service providers, or individual customers. Coupled with this, networks need to support both internet protocol version 4 (IPv4) and internet protocol version 6 (IPv6) seamlessly to mitigate the transition risks as more customers consider the shift to IPv6.
